Ephesus Cafe is a new Turkish and Mediterranean restaurant coming to the heart of the Old Ashburn neighborhood. And now, we’ve got a first look at the menu and even a planned opening date.
The new restaurant is located at 20937 Ashburn Road, No. 125 — and the new owners are giving the restaurant a different name and menu.
The name is still a bit of a mystery. The restaurant’s website and menu read just plain Ephesus. A sign on the door said Efesus Cafe with an “f” instead of a “ph.” The website URL is efesuscafe.com, but the restaurant’s email says “ephesuscafe.”
Regardless, the menu displayed on the website looks great. Starters include a Yayla Soup, made with yogurt, mint, and rice; and Spicy Ezme, which is a fiery blend of tomatoes, peppers, and herbs.
Entrees include a Lamb Shank, served with roasted eggplant and fluffy rice; a Spicy Chicken Bow Tie Pasta; and a Chicken Adana Kebab. You can see the full Ephesus menu below.
As far as when the new restaurant plans to open — a countdown timer on the website is ticking away towards a Tuesday, January 2 opening — one month from today.
